‘Fallout’ TV Series at Amazon Casts Walton Goggins

Joe Otterson TV ReporterThe “Fallout” TV series at Amazon has cast Walton Goggins in a lead role, Variety has learned.Like the video games on which it is based, the “Fallout” series is set in a world where the future envisioned by Americans in the late 1940s explodes upon itself through a nuclear war in 2077.Amazon had no comment on the character Goggins will play in the series. According to sources, he will play a character based on the ghouls from the games.

Keri Russell to Star in Netflix Drama Series ‘The Diplomat’

Joe Otterson TV ReporterKeri Russell has been cast in the lead role of the upcoming Netflix series “The Diplomat.”The series was ordered at the streamer in January. In the series, in the midst of an international crisis, a career diplomat (Russell) lands in a high-profile job she’s unsuited for, with tectonic implications for her marriage and her political future.Debora Cahn created the series and also serves as executive producer and showrunner.

Andrew Rannells Joins Hulu Chippendales Limited Series ‘Immigrant’

Joe Otterson TV ReporterAndrew Rannells has been cast in a recurring role in the upcoming Hulu limited series “Immigrant.”The darkly comedic series tells the true story of Somen “Steve” Banerjee (Kumail Nanjiani), the Indian-American entrepreneur who started Chippendales. Along with Nanjiani and Rannells, the cast also includes Murray Bartlett and Annaleigh Ashford.Rannells will play the rich kid investor in Chippendales New York and the love interest of Bartlett, who stars as producer-choreographer Nick De Noia.Rannells’ recent onscreen roles include “Black Monday” at Showtime and “Girls5Eva” at Peacock.

Rashida Jones to Star in Dark Comedy Series ‘Sunny’ at Apple

Joe Otterson TV ReporterApple has ordered the dark comedy series “Sunny” with Rashida Jones set to star, Variety has confirmed.The 10-episode series is based on the book “Dark Manual” by Colin O’Sullivan. In the half-hour show, Jones stars as Suzie, an American woman living in Kyoto, Japan, whose life is upended when her husband and son disappear in a mysterious plane crash. As “consolation” she’s given Sunny, one of a new class of domestic robots made by her husband’s electronics company.

‘Orphan Black’ sequel series in the works at AMC

Orphan Black sequel series is officially in the works at AMC.The project, which was first reported in 2019, has found its writer with the writers’ room now having opened for the forthcoming show.Orphan Black ran from 2013 to 2017, with Tatiana Maslany playing a woman named Sarah and her “cloned sisters” in a present-day science-fiction thriller.According to Variety, Anna Fishko has joined the project to write and executive produce the series although plot details remain under wraps at the time of writing.It remains unclear whether Maslany will reprise her roles for the project, while it’s been confirmed that it will be a sequel set in the same universe (as opposed to a reboot).Meanwhile, Maslany was cast in the lead role of Marvel’s spin-off series She-Hulk at Disney+ in 2020.She will play Jennifer Walters, cousin of Bruce Banner, who inherits Banner’s Hulk powers via a blood transfusion, and is said to keep the character’s “personality, intelligence and emotional control”.The series will be directed by Kat Coiro, who will also act as executive producer. Jessica Gao will write the series and also act as the show’s executive producer and showrunner.

FX Limited Series ‘The Patient’ Casts ‘GLOW’ Alum Alex Rich (EXCLUSIVE)

Joe Otterson TV ReporterThe upcoming FX limited series “The Patient” has cast Alex Rich in a recurring role, Variety has learned exclusively.Rich joins previously announced series leads Steve Carell and Domhnall Gleeson as well as cast members Linda Emond, Laura Niemi, and Andrew Leeds in the series, which hails from “The Americans” duo Joe Weisberg and Joel Fields.In the half-hour series, a psychotherapist (Carell) finds himself held prisoner by a serial killer (Gleeson) with an unusual request: curb his homicidal urges. But unwinding the mind of this man while also dealing with the waves of his own repressed troubles creates a journey perhaps as treacherous as his captivity.Rich previously appeared in the critically-acclaimed Netflix series “GLOW” in the role of Florian, the butler and best friend of Sebastian “Bash” Howard.

Michelle Yeoh Among Eight Cast in Disney Plus Series ‘American Born Chinese’

Joe Otterson TV ReporterThe upcoming “American Born Chinese” series adaptation at Disney Plus has found its main cast, Variety has confirmed.Ben Wang, Michelle Yeoh, Yeo Yann Yann, Daniel Wu, Chin Han, Ke Huy Quan, Jim Liu, and Sydney Taylor will all star in the series, based on the graphic novel of the same name by Gene Luen Yang.The series follows Jin Wang (Ben Wang), a teenager juggling his high school social life with his immigrant home life. When Jin meets a new foreign exchange student (Jim Liu) on the first day of school, their worlds collide as Jin becomes entangled in a battle of Chinese mythological gods.

‘National Treasure’ Disney Plus Series Casts Catherine Zeta-Jones

Joe Otterson TV ReporterCatherine Zeta-Jones has been cast in the upcoming “National Treasure” series at Disney Plus, Variety has learned.Zeta-Jones joins previously announced cast members Lisette Alexis, Zuri Reed, Jordan Rodrigues, Antonio Cipriano, and Jake Austin Walker, and Lyndon Smith in the series continuation of the film franchise of the same name. Production is set to begin this month in Baton Rouge, LA.The series focuses on a young heroine, Jess (Alexis), a brilliant and resourceful DREAMer who embarks on the adventure of a lifetime to uncover the truth about her family’s mysterious past and save a lost Pan-American treasure.Zeta-Jones will portray Billie, described as a badass billionaire, black-market antiquities expert, and treasure hunter who lives by her own code.

‘LA Law’ Sequel Series Pilot at ABC Casts John Harlan Kim (EXCLUSIVE)

Joe Otterson TV ReporterThe “LA Law” sequel series pilot at ABC has added John Harlan Kim to its cast, Variety has learned exclusively.The new iteration of the Emmy-winning series features familiar characters working alongside new ones on the most hot button issues of the day.Kim joins previously announced returning original series cast members Blair Underwood and Corbin Bernsen. Kim will star as Chad Park, an up-and-coming attorney at the firm described as a “shark-in-training” whose ambition sometimes gets ahead of his ethical standards.
